+.B clean|mask
+This subcommand takes input of either 1) an sosreport tarball, 2) a collection
+of sosreport tarballs such as from \fBcollect\fR, or 3) the unpackaged
+directory of an sosreport and obfuscates potentially sensitive system information
+that is not covered by the standard postprocessing of \fBsos report\fR.
+
+Such data includes IP addresses, networks, MAC addresses, and more. Data obfuscated
+by this command will remain consistent throughout the report and across reports provided
+in the same invocation. Additionally, care is taken to maintain network topology relationships
+between matched data items.
+
+See \fB sos clean --help\fR and \fBman sos-clean\fR for more information.
+
+May be invoked via either \fBsos clean\fR, \fBsos mask\fR, or via the \fB--clean\fR or \fB --mask\fR options
+for \fBreport\fR and \fBcollect\fR.

+.B \--encrypt-key KEY
+Encrypts the resulting archive that sosreport produces using GPG. KEY must be
+an existing key in the user's keyring as GPG does not allow for keyfiles.
+KEY can be any value accepted by gpg's 'recipient' option.
+
+Note that the user running sosreport must match the user owning the keyring
+from which keys will be obtained. In particular this means that if sudo is
+used to run sosreport, the keyring must also be set up using sudo
+(or direct shell access to the account).
+
+Users should be aware that encrypting the final archive will result in sos
+using double the amount of temporary disk space - the encrypted archive must be
+written as a separate, rather than replacement, file within the temp directory
+that sos writes the archive to. However, since the encrypted archive will be
+the same size as the original archive, there is no additional space consumption
+once the temporary directory is removed at the end of execution.
+
+This means that only the encrypted archive is present on disk after sos
+finishes running.
+
+If encryption fails for any reason, the original unencrypted archive is
+preserved instead.
+.TP
+.B \--encrypt-pass PASS
+The same as \--encrypt-key, but use the provided PASS for symmetric encryption
+rather than key-pair encryption.
